Blue Coat Climbs to Second in WAN Optimisation Market Share

Farnborough based Blue Coat Systems a provider of WAN Application Delivery and Secure Web Gateway, today announced that a new report from Gartner, Inc., the world’s leading information technology research and advisory company, ranks Blue Coat second in worldwide market share for WAN optimisation controllers during the first calendar quarter of 2008

Previously, in Gartner’s report for the fourth calendar quarter of 2007, Blue Coat had ranked third in market share. According to the Gartner report, “Market Share: Application Acceleration Equipment, Worldwide, 1Q08,” Blue Coat grew its revenue while two other prominent vendors decreased in revenue.

In the same report, Packeteer, Inc., which was acquired by Blue Coat in the second calendar quarter of 2008, achieved the strongest percentage growth of any vendor reported. Packeteer ranked as fourth in market share. Going forward, Packeteer revenue will be included with Blue Coat revenue.
